1/2 cup or more whole wheat noodles or noodles of your choice
1/2 can diced tomatoes
1/2 cup or more dairy-free cream cheese
Directions
Cook pasta according to package instructions. While draining pasta, melt cream cheese in saucepan, then add pasta and tomatoes and heat through. Very easy and very yummy!
Notes
Substitutions
If not avoiding dairy, you can use regular cream cheese.
Use whatever type of pasta is safe for you.
Be sure to check the canned tomatoes for hidden ingredients.
Gluten: Gluten is a protein found in specific grains (wheat, spelt, kamut, barley, rye). Other grains are naturally gluten-free but may have cross-contact with gluten-containing grains. Look for certified gluten-free products if you need to avoid gluten. Find out more about wheat and gluten substitutions.
